This subcontract focuses on the development and integration of next-generation Cross Domain Solution brokers for prime contractors supporting AFRL Rome Research Site projects. The primary objective is to research and implement secure information sharing capabilities at the tactical edge across ground, air, and space nodes, utilizing Red/Black boundary hardware and architectures compliant with JADC2. The project requires the delivery of field-testable prototypes and demonstrations reaching Technology Readiness Level 5. Due to the sensitive nature of the work, participating entities must possess DLIS registration and maintain Secret or Top Secret facility and personnel clearances. The effort falls under NAICS code 541511 and is managed by the Department of Defense under the FA8750 Afrl Rik agency.
